Neemrana is an important historic town located 90 km from Gurgaon in Rajasthan. It lies on the Delhi-Jaipur highway and is home to a 14th century hill fort that was once ruled by the Chauhan dynasty. The most famous tourist attraction in Neemrana is the Neemrana Fort, built in 1464 AD, which was once the third capital of Prithviraj Chauhan III's descendants. The fort was chosen by Raja Rajdeo and derives its name from a local chieftain Nimola Meo who lost his kingdom to the Chauhans.
